A Littlewood Axe

I was looking through a box of my tools recently and came across this 5lb English pattern felling axe, marked I.Littlewood, Sheffield.

The name was not a familiar one on edge tools and doing some research I found an article by Ken Hawley (Tools & Trades Vol.7) regarding this firm. These axes went out of use some time ago as methods changed and despite being a bit rusty it is what looks to be unused condition. It was very likely manufactured at the Clough Works between 1889 and 1904. According to Ken's article they made a lot of tools for other Sheffield manufacturers and marked as such. It would be interesting to know of any other I.Littlewood tools.
